Description
The barn, located 40 metres east of Boode Farmhouse, is likely from the 18th century. It is constructed of rubble, with the rear rendered and a gable-ended slate roof. At the rear, there is a horse engine house featuring a corrugated iron roof supported by two pairs of circular piers and squared end piers. The barn has a central double cart entrance with 20th-century doors and a blocked opening to the right filled with cob. Inside, four raised crucks remain intact, along with two tiers of trenched purlins. The angle struts have been removed, and the collars have been replaced.
